Total greenhouse gas emissions excluding LULUCF per capita in China
China: Total greenhouse gas emissions excluding LULUCF per capita was 11.03 t CO2e/capita in 2024. ◆ Volatile
Total greenhouse gas emissions excluding LULUCF per capita in China, 1970–2024
Source: EDGAR (Emissions Database for Global Atmospheric Research) Community GHG Database, Joint Research Centre (JRC) - European Commission. Measured in t CO2e/capita.
Analysis
In 2024, total greenhouse gas emissions excluding lulucf per capita in China stood at 11.03 t CO2e/capita. That is the highest value across all 55 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 0.9% on the previous year and up 15.5% over ten years.
Over the whole period, total greenhouse gas emissions excluding lulucf per capita in China peaked at 11.03 t CO2e/capita in 2024 and was at its lowest, 2.08 t CO2e/capita, in 1971.
That places China 29th out of 203 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the top qu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Total greenhouse gas emissions excluding LULUCF per capita in China, year by year
| Year | t CO2e/capita |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 1970 | 2.1 t CO2e/capita | — |
| 1971 | 2.08 t CO2e/capita | -0.9% |
| 1972 | 2.12 t CO2e/capita | +1.9% |
| 1973 | 2.13 t CO2e/capita | +0.7% |
| 1974 | 2.11 t CO2e/capita | -1.0% |
| 1975 | 2.28 t CO2e/capita | +7.9% |
| 1976 | 2.31 t CO2e/capita | +1.4% |
| 1977 | 2.48 t CO2e/capita | +7.2% |
| 1978 | 2.67 t CO2e/capita | +7.6% |
| 1979 | 2.69 t CO2e/capita | +0.9% |
| 1980 | 2.63 t CO2e/capita | -2.1% |
| 1981 | 2.58 t CO2e/capita | -2.1% |
| 1982 | 2.64 t CO2e/capita | +2.3% |
| 1983 | 2.72 t CO2e/capita | +3.0% |
| 1984 | 2.87 t CO2e/capita | +5.5% |
| 1985 | 2.85 t CO2e/capita | -0.8% |
| 1986 | 2.94 t CO2e/capita | +3.2% |
| 1987 | 3.06 t CO2e/capita | +4.3% |
| 1988 | 3.19 t CO2e/capita | +4.1% |
| 1989 | 3.25 t CO2e/capita | +2.0% |
| 1990 | 3.27 t CO2e/capita | +0.7% |
| 1991 | 3.34 t CO2e/capita | +2.2% |
| 1992 | 3.4 t CO2e/capita | +1.9% |
| 1993 | 3.54 t CO2e/capita | +4.0% |
| 1994 | 3.65 t CO2e/capita | +3.2% |
| 1995 | 3.95 t CO2e/capita | +8.2% |
| 1996 | 3.92 t CO2e/capita | -0.9% |
| 1997 | 3.9 t CO2e/capita | -0.5% |
| 1998 | 3.94 t CO2e/capita | +1.2% |
| 1999 | 3.87 t CO2e/capita | -1.8% |
| 2000 | 4.01 t CO2e/capita | +3.6% |
| 2001 | 4.13 t CO2e/capita | +3.0% |
| 2002 | 4.36 t CO2e/capita | +5.6% |
| 2003 | 4.88 t CO2e/capita | +12.0% |
| 2004 | 5.5 t CO2e/capita | +12.7% |
| 2005 | 6.12 t CO2e/capita | +11.2% |
| 2006 | 6.68 t CO2e/capita | +9.2% |
| 2007 | 7.1 t CO2e/capita | +6.3% |
| 2008 | 7.23 t CO2e/capita | +1.8% |
| 2009 | 7.66 t CO2e/capita | +6.0% |
| 2010 | 8.27 t CO2e/capita | +8.0% |
| 2011 | 8.96 t CO2e/capita | +8.4% |
| 2012 | 9.17 t CO2e/capita | +2.3% |
| 2013 | 9.5 t CO2e/capita | +3.6% |
| 2014 | 9.55 t CO2e/capita | +0.5% |
| 2015 | 9.37 t CO2e/capita | -1.8% |
| 2016 | 9.3 t CO2e/capita | -0.7% |
| 2017 | 9.43 t CO2e/capita | +1.3% |
| 2018 | 9.8 t CO2e/capita | +3.9% |
| 2019 | 9.98 t CO2e/capita | +1.9% |
| 2020 | 10.08 t CO2e/capita | +1.0% |
| 2021 | 10.53 t CO2e/capita | +4.4% |
| 2022 | 10.52 t CO2e/capita | -0.0% |
| 2023 | 10.92 t CO2e/capita | +3.8% |
| 2024 | 11.03 t CO2e/capita | +0.9% |

About this data
Total annual emissions of the six greenhouse gases (GHG) covered by the Kyoto Protocol (carbon dioxide (CO2), methane (CH4), nitrous oxide (N2O), hydrofluorocarbons (HFCs), perfluorocarbons (PFCs), and sulphurhexafluoride (SF6)) from the energy, industry, waste, and agriculture sectors, standardized to carbon dioxide equivalent values divided by the economy's population. This measure excludes GHG fluxes caused by Land Use Change and Forestry (LULUCF), as these fluxes have larger uncertainties.
